Patrick Steinhardt b14cbae2b5 builtin/show-ref: split up different subcommands
While not immediately obvious, git-show-ref(1) actually implements three
different subcommands:

    - `git show-ref <patterns>` can be used to list references that
      match a specific pattern.

    - `git show-ref --verify <refs>` can be used to list references.
      These are _not_ patterns.

    - `git show-ref --exclude-existing` can be used as a filter that
      reads references from standard input, performing some conversions
      on each of them.

Let's make this more explicit in the code by splitting up the three
subcommands into separate functions. This also allows us to address the
confusingly named `patterns` variable, which may hold either patterns or
reference names.

/*
* read "^(?:<anything>\s)?<refname>(?:\^\{\})?$" from the standard input,
* and
* (1) strip "^{}" at the end of line if any;
* (2) ignore if match is provided and does not head-match refname;
* (3) warn if refname is not a well-formed refname and skip;
* (4) ignore if refname is a ref that exists in the local repository;
* (5) otherwise output the line.
*/
static int cmd_show_ref__exclude_existing(const char *match)
{
static struct string_list existing_refs = STRING_LIST_INIT_DUP;
char buf[1024];
int matchlen = match ? strlen(match) : 0;
for_each_ref(add_existing, &existing_refs);
while (fgets(buf, sizeof(buf), stdin)) {
char *ref;
int len = strlen(buf);
if (len > 0 && buf[len - 1] == '\n')
buf[--len] = '\0';
if (3 <= len && !strcmp(buf + len - 3, "^{}")) {
len -= 3;
buf[len] = '\0';
}
for (ref = buf + len; buf < ref; ref--)
if (isspace(ref[-1]))
break;
if (match) {
int reflen = buf + len - ref;
if (reflen < matchlen)
continue;
if (strncmp(ref, match, matchlen))
continue;
}
if (check_refname_format(ref, 0)) {
warning("ref '%s' ignored", ref);
continue;
}
if (!string_list_has_string(&existing_refs, ref)) {
printf("%s\n", buf);
}
}
return 0;
}
